  No, it isn't like INFO-UNIX.

  The INFO-UNIX mailing list is gatewayed to the newsgroup
comp.unix.questions.  This means that mail sent to the mailing list is posted
to the newsgroup automatically, and postings to the newsgroup are sent out (in
digests, I believe) to the members of the mailing list.

  This means that people who do not have access to the Usenet can participate
in INFO-UNIX.

  On the other hand, comp.sys.m88k is not (as far as I can tell) gatewayed to
any mailing list.  This means that the only way to access it is through the
Usenet.  If you do not have access to the Usenet (a.k.a. Network News, a.k.a
NetNews), then you do not have access to comp.sys.m88k.

  I do not know if your site has any sort of Usenet access, and I doubt that
the vast majority of people on this list know, since that is something that is
very specific to your site.  You will have to check with your site
administrators about that.
